Outstanding All Girls School located in Twickenham looking to hire a strong Science teacher for September - £140 to £230

An outstanding all girls school located in Twickenham is currently looking to hire a Science teacher for September. The school can be quite flexible regarding hours as they are able to offer both full time or part time hours for the forth coming academic year.

Science teacher needed for an outstanding school based in Twickenham - September start - £140 to £230 a day

Please do not apply if the below requirements do not apply to you

Requirements

  • Teachers require relevant teaching qualifications (QTS,PGCE or similar)
    • NQTs would be considered for this role depending on feedback from PGCE placements
  • Science teachers must have experience teaching either Biology, Chemistry or Physics up to key stage 4 at a minimum
  • The successful teacher would be require to plan, prepare and mark students work
  • All applicants must hold an enhanced child workforce DBS on the update service, or are willing to apply for one (assistance will be provided)
  • Must be able to provide a full and complete 6 year career history, with two graded (performance based) references from your two most recent education based roles

This outstanding school is looking for a strong classroom practitioner to work from September to continue the high standard the Science department has set. With interviews commencing the week after half term there is an opportunity for an ambitious teacher to join a strong Science department and progress their career.
